An interesting takeaway I have from this quote:

Quote

That patience will come in handy as he enters the next phase of growth for Entertainment Studios Inc., where, in true Allen style, nothing short of total global domination is the plan. "I'm close to the same age when Rupert Murdoch came here to America," he says. "He was in his 50s. I'm 59. What you see today will be 10,000 times bigger." Press him on what would make the ultimate jewel in his crown and, without hesitation, he replies, "I'd love to own CNN. But I have to buy AT&T to do that. And I will. Believe me, I think about it every day."

Allen has big and bold visions for building his broadcasting empire and quite frankly I don't think he's nuts when he said he wants to own CNN. I think he truly wants to own CNN.
